I love to read, my Amy really loves to read; and can read faster than anyone I know - as a teenager she would stay up most of the night reading. And, if you love to read there is a new gadget out there that you must have:
A READER - I bought the Kindle from Amazon.  Amy bought the "Nook" from Barnes and Noble.  Verizon also has put out a reader and there are many more out there.  Amy bought the Nook mainly because you can down load books from your local library; a feature that I hope Amazon will add to the Kindle in the future.  I mainly chose the Kindle because you can read it or it will read to you (male or female voice), which is nice since I can knit while listening and Dave and I can listen to a book when we are traveling.
